Last spring I was training for a trail race in Moab, running about 3 days a week. After a very mellow morning run my left ankle seized up and I could barely walk. Nothing happened on the run. I didn't roll it or trip. It just decided it was done and didn't want to move or support me anymore. A few days later I went to my primary care doctor since my othropedic could not see me for 6 weeks. They put me in a boot and I leaned into my new hobbling reality.
Weeks passed and my othropedic appointment finally arrived. X-rays show significant talonavicular arthritis with a history of navicular AVN along with talar head flattening. There is significant arthritis bone-on-bone with a large dorsal osteophyte. To sum it up; not good. At which point she handed me a soft $2 wedge to put in my shoe and said "Katie, the horse has left the building, there is nothing we can do but fuse the ankle". I love being outside moving my body and this diagnosis was a little heartbreaking. I was furious. After some tears were shed, I decided to look for other possibilities.

With a little PT, a healthy dose of acupuncture, some good friends and a reframe of which movements actually feel good in my body, I was back outside. Fast forward a year, I can mountain bike, rock climb, lift weights, hike and go to pilates. Running is out (for the moment).
All of this is to remind you to not let any one thing (or person) hold you back and that our bodies are incredibly adaptable if we get out of the way and listen to them.

Microneddling and facial cupping . As I lean into my mid 40's I am taking extra care with my face. I have a lot of skin damage from summers spent at the jersey shore. My go to solution is microneedling every 8 weeks, facial cupping 3-4 days/week and using herbal face food or uma oils every day. The results have been mind-blowing; more even skin tone, clearer skin, less wrinkles around my eyes and mouth (still working on the forehead) and practically no breakouts.
Microneedling, also known as collagen induction therapy, is a minimally invasive skin rejuvenation procedure that helps minimize the signs of aging, improve the appearance of acne scars and rejuvenate aging skin. $150/treatment
Facial Cupping increases circulation, stimulates collagen production, relaxes jaw tension and strengthens skin and connective tissue. $50 add on to acupuncture treatment
